> Rhe {{CombineFileInputFormat}} class is responsible for grouping blocks 
> together to form larger splits.  The current implementation is very naive.  
> It iterates over the list of available blocks and as long as the current 
> group of blocks is less than the maximum split size, it will keep added 
> blocks.  The check for if a split has reached its maximum size happens 
> *after* each block is added.  For example given a certain maximum "M", and 
> two blocks which are both 7/8M, they will be grouped together to create a 
> split which is 14/8M.  If M is a large number, this split will be very large 
> and not what the operator would expect.
> I'll propose a general clean up and also, enforcing that, unless a files 
> cannot be split, that its splits will not be larger than the configured 
> maximum size.  This will provide operators a much more straight-forward way 
> of calculating the expected number of splits.
